  • What types of fishing trips do you offer?

    We provide both inshore and nearshore fishing trips tailored to target species like redfish, snook, tarpon, and grouper in Sarasota’s diverse waters.

    Each trip is designed to match your skill level and preferences, whether you want a relaxed day or an action-packed adventure.

  • How do I book a fishing trip?

    You can book your trip by calling our office directly. We recommend booking at least two weeks in advance to secure your preferred date.

  • What equipment do you provide?

    We supply high-quality rods, reels, tackle, and bait suited for the targeted species on your trip.

    If you have personal gear, you’re welcome to bring it along, but our equipment is maintained to professional standards for optimal performance.

  • What should I bring on the trip?

    Bring sunscreen, a hat, sunglasses, comfortable clothing, and any personal items like snacks or drinks you prefer.


  • What happens if the weather is bad?

    Safety is our priority. If conditions are unsafe, we will reschedule your trip or offer a full refund.

    We monitor weather closely and communicate promptly to adjust plans as needed for your protection.

  • Can beginners join your trips?

    Absolutely. Our captains provide guidance and support to anglers of all experience levels to ensure an enjoyable outing.

    We tailor the trip pace and techniques to match your comfort and skill, making it a great choice for first-timers.
